Actually, the more I think about making LC keto mince pies, the more I cringe at the thought of the hassle.
I am SUCH a lazy cook.

So I looked at bought mincemeat and the carbs are 15g/tablespoon - which is pretty horrific, but it is LESS horrific that actually having to make pastry and mincemeat.
Yup, I am that lazy.

Plus of course that I probably won't want to eat more than a couple of them all Xmas, and nobody else will want to eat LC mincepies when there are our local butcher's crumble topping mince pies (45g carbs ea) around. They are divine. And Mr B was torturing me yesterday by opening a pack and eating them in front of me.

There is only so much self control a girl can generate.

So I had a brainwave.

I will make one of these
image.axd

http://ketodietapp.com/Blog/post/2015/10/30/vanilla-keto-mug-cake

with a large teasp of mincemeat dropped into it before cooking.
It will sink during cooking, so if I turn the cooked mug cake out, it will (like an upsidedown cake) have molten mincemeat dribbling down over the vanilla cake.
Lush.
